refactor(tree-sitter): major mode remapping

This approach simplifies the hacks and uses fewer moving parts to be
less error prone (or prone to potentially overwriting user/module
configuration).

;; HACK: Some *-ts-mode packages modify `major-mode-remap-defaults'
;; inconsistently. Playing whack-a-mole to undo those changes is more hassle
;; then simply ignoring them (by overriding `major-mode-remap-defaults' for
;; any modes remapped with `set-tree-sitter!'). The user shouldn't touch
;; `major-mode-remap-defaults' anyway; `major-mode-remap-alist' will always
;; have precedence.
;; HACK: Intercept all ts-mode major mode remappings so grammars can be
;; dynamically checked and `treesit-auto-install-grammar' can be
;; consistently respected (which isn't currently the case with the majority
;; of ts-modes, even the built-in ones).

;; HACK: The implementation of `treesit-enabled-modes's setter and
;; `treesit-major-mode-remap-alist' is intrusively opinionated, so disable
;; it ato avoid untimely (and overriding) modifications of
;; `major-mode-remap-alist' at runtime. What's more, this was only
;; introduced in 31, so ignoring them is more consistent for pre-31 users.
(when major-mode-remap-alist
(dolist (m treesit-major-mode-remap-alist)
(setq major-mode-remap-alist (delete m major-mode-remap-alist))))
(setq treesit-major-mode-remap-alist nil)
